The restricted shell mode is only one component of a useful restricted
|
||||
environment. It should be accompanied by setting 'PATH' to a value that
|
||||
allows execution of only a few verified commands (commands that allow
|
||||
shell escapes are particularly vulnerable), leaving the user in a
|
||||
non-writable directory other than his home directory after login, not
|
||||
allowing the restricted shell to execute shell scripts, and cleaning the
|
||||
environment of variables that cause some commands to modify their
|
||||
behavior (e.g., 'VISUAL' or 'PAGER').
|
||||
|
||||
Modern systems provide more secure ways to implement a restricted
|
||||
environment, such as 'jails', 'zones', or 'containers'.
